- The distance between Caravelas, Brazil and Lodgepole, Ne, Usa is approximately 9,253 km or 5,750 mi.
- To reach Caravelas in this distance one would set out from Lodgepole, Ne bearing 120.7° or ESE and follow the great circles arc to approach Caravelas bearing 137° or SE .
- Caravelas has a tropical rainforest climate (Af) whereas Lodgepole, Ne has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k).
- Caravelas is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Lodgepole, Ne is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ome.
- The average annual temperature is 14.3 °C (25.7°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 22.8 °C (41°F) less in Caravelas.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 922.1 mm (36.3 in) more which is equivalent to 922.1 l/m² (22.63 US gal/ft²) or 9,221,000 l/ha (985,786 US gal/ac) more. About 3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 20.5° higher in Caravelas than in Lodgepole, Ne.
